Описание функции wp_cache_flush_runtime()
Функция wp_cache_flush_runtime() очищает все кэши, связанные с текущим временем выполнения скрипта. Это может быть полезно в случаях, когда необходимо сбросить кэш для обновления данных или устранения несоответствий. Функция часто используется в плагинах и темах, особенно при разработке, где требуется обновление данных в кэше.
Возвращаемое значение
Тип: void
Описание: Функция ничего не возвращает
Возможные значения:
• void — функция не имеет возвращаемого значения
Примеры использования
Очистка кэша после обновления данных в плагине
$this->flush_cache();
wp_cache_flush_runtime();
Используется для обновления кэша после изменения настроек
Очистка кэша перед получением свежих данных
wp_cache_flush_runtime();
$data = get_data();
// вывод данных
Гарантирует, что данные будут актуальными
Безопасность
Валидация входных данных: Функция не принимает параметры, поэтому валидация не требуется
Санитизация: Отсутствует необходимость в очистке входных данных
Рекомендации: Используйте функцию осторожно, чтобы избежать чрезмерного сброса кэша
— Связанные функции
Устанавливает данные в кэш
Получает данные из кэша
— Примечания
– Ограничения
Очистка кэша может привести к увеличению времени отклика приложения
– Частые проблемы
- Чрезмерное использование функции может вызвать проблемы с производительностью
- Необходимо учитывать контекст, в котором используется функция